Transaction 81261b95424e959289bf05403b155abf2a3bfaf154aa893a1bdb1786bb613ed6
1 Input
1 Output
-
81261b95424e959289bf05403b155abf2a3bfaf154aa893a1bdb1786bb613ed6:0
- value
- 82671322
- script pubkey
- OP_0 OP_PUSHBYTES_20 8720ee2315728f79229f590d6ec0a57b5a109758
- address
- bc1qsuswugc4w28hjg5ltyxkas990ddpp96cz35s8g